In 2021, the enumerated population of Lac-Despinassy (Unorganized), was 21, which represents a change of 110.0% from 2016. This compares to the provincial average of 4.1% and the national average of 5.2%.

37.5%

In 2021, there were 11 private dwellings occupied in Lac-Despinassy (Unorganized), which represent a change of 37.5% from 2016.

0.0

The land area of Lac-Despinassy (Unorganized) is 1,848.65 square kilometres and the population density was 0.0 people per square kilometre.
